How We Calculate Calories Burned for Rugby in Manchester
Our calculator uses the standard MET (Metabolic Equivalent of Task) formula with a local climate adjustment for Manchester:
Calories = MET × Weight (kg) × Duration (hrs) × Climate Factor
= 8.3 × Weight (kg) × Duration (hrs) × 1.03
The MET value of 8.3 for rugby is sourced from the Compendium of Physical Activities. The climate factor of 1.03 accounts for Manchester's average temperature of 42°F. Research shows that exercising in non-neutral temperatures increases energy expenditure as the body works to maintain its core temperature.
Rugby is one of the most physically demanding team sports, combining continuous running with tackling, rucking, and ball handling. A rugby match involves covering 5-7 miles while also performing dozens of physical collisions and explosive movements. The sport develops extraordinary cardiovascular endurance, full-body strength, mental toughness, and teamwork. Rugby requires athletes to be strong, fast, agile, and durable, making it one of the most complete sporting activities for overall fitness development.
